About MLR Miller Industries Inc.

Miller Industries Inc is engaged in the manufacturing of vehicle towing and recovery equipment. The company produces wreckers, car carriers, and trailer bodies under the Century, Vulcan, Challenger, Holmes, Champion, Chevron, Eagle, Titan, Jige, and Boniface brands. The products are sold in North America, Canada, and Mexico through independent distributors.

About DNUT Krispy Kreme Inc.

Krispy Kreme Inc is a sweet treat brand company. The company's Original Glazed doughnut is recognized for its hot-off-the-line, melt-in-your-mouth experience. It operates through its network of fresh Doughnut Shops, partnerships with retailers, and a growing e-commerce and delivery business. The company conducts its business through the following three reported segments: U.S., which includes all operations in the United States; International, which includes operations in the U.K., Ireland, Australia, New Zealand, Canada, Japan, and Mexico; and Market Development, which includes franchise operations across the globe. It derives maximum revenue from the U.S. segment.
